    I recently started playing a Meinl Headliner Series cajon (Flamenco-type). The only tuning I have done is to loosen the upper screws to allow the upper corners of the front plate to separate from the body a bit, to emphasize the slap tone. I am pretty happy with the overall sound, but at some point, I'm sure I will adjust the middle screws and string tension, just to see how those changes affect the sound. Thanks for the video!

    Hello Felipe, thank you so much for the video. I have a Meinl Artisan Cajon Tango Line, and the buzzing I have is a little different than when you loosened the front place. It kind of sounds like it resonates after the initial hit. In order to fix it, should I tighten the front plate? Also, how do I know if it’s too tight. I’m kind of scared to tune it, because I never tuned it before.

    • @CajonMaster
      @CajonMaster  Před rokem +1

      This could work. But have a look inside the cajon and check the strings, sometimes the solution can be a little piece of tape just to eliminate the buzz from a string. And to tighten up or loosen up, on this artisans cajons, the adjustments are very subtle don’t tight too much 😉
